Trainer relaxed about Derby jockey
18 March 2016
Connections of What’s The Story are in no rush to confirm a rider for their colt in the $A2 million Gr.1 Australian Derby.
“It’s easier to wait until after the Rosehill Guineas when the jockeys have sorted themselves out,” co-trainer Stephen McKee said.
What’s The Story had a quiet week after finishing runner-up in the Gr.1 New Zealand Derby and he will travel to Australia four days before the Randwick feature on April 2.
“He’s got the base fitness and he’ll have a couple of decent gallops before he goes over,” McKee said.
